(4) The principal operator of your business must attend mandatory training in Hastings, Minnesota or<br />

such other place we designate. In addition, if your principal operator is not also the person that will own a<br />

controlling interest in your Anytime Fitness center, then the person holding the controlling interest must<br />

also attend and complete this training to our satisfaction before you open your Anytime Fitness center.<br />

While we do not charge you for this training, you do have to pay your travel and living expenses while<br />

you attend the training. Your actual cost will vary, depending on the distance to be traveled, your method<br />

of travel, and your personal circumstances.<br />

(5) Our estimate for initial expenses for real estate and improvements assumes you will lease space for<br />

your Anytime Fitness center. If you open an Anytime Fitness center, you should have at least 2,500<br />

square feet, and we recommend that you not have more than 5,500 square feet for your center. An<br />

Anytime Fitness Express center would generally have less than 2,500 square feet. All our estimates are<br />

based on these assumptions. Rent for these locations will typically vary from $10.00 to $25.00 per square<br />

foot per year. Our franchise model is based on minimizing overhead expenses, including real estate costs.<br />

Costs will vary in relation to the physical size and location ofthe fitness center. A lower cost center is<br />

one that would require fewer leasehold improvements and fewer equipment expenditures. The lower<br />

estimates assumes the landlord will cover many ofthe leasehold improvement costs, as well as free rent.<br />

You may also need to provide a security deposit and a personal guaranty of the lease. Moderate and<br />

higher cost fitness centers may require extensive interior renovations and additional equipment. The<br />

above figures do not include extensive renovations.<br />

(6) Our estimate for equipment assumes you lease all the equipment. The estimate therefore covers only<br />

the security deposit and other up-front costs. The total cost of equipment will vary depending on various<br />

factors, including whether you purchase or lease the equipment, and what equipment you obtain. If you<br />

choose not to lease your equipment or leasing is not available, your initial investment for fitness<br />

equipment, tanning equipment, and operating systems (not including monitoring costs), will increase to:<br />

Anvtime Fitness Anvtime Fitness EXDress<br />

Exercise Equipment $70,000 to $120,000 $40,000 to $70,000<br />

Tanning Equipment Approximately $8,000 Approximately $4,000<br />

Operating System $11,000 to $24,000 $8,000 to $14,000<br />

If you purchase this equipment, the amount of Additional Funds for the 3 months operating expenses<br />

would also be adjusted to reflect that you will not make 3 monthly equipment lease payments, but your<br />

total initial investment will be substantially higher than we have estimated. Some costs will vary in<br />

relation to the physical size of the fitness center and whether you purchase from our recommended<br />

sources or from others. Exercise equipment includes fitness equipment, security devices, access<br />

equipment, televisions and/or stereo, durable floor pads, decorations and fixtures.<br />
